summaryrefslogtreecommitdiff
path: root/src/gallium/drivers/radeonsi
AgeCommit message (Expand)AuthorFilesLines
2018-08-15radv: disable the auto-waitcnt-before-barrier LLVM optionSamuel Pitoiset1-0/+1
2018-08-14radeonsi: enable 1 missing PS_SU perf counter on PolarisMarek Olšák1-1/+1
2018-08-14radeonsi: use radeon_info::nameMarek Olšák3-40/+12
2018-08-14radeonsi: split si_clear_buffer to remove enum si_methodMarek Olšák6-53/+60
2018-08-14radeonsi: replace CP_DMA_USE_L2 with enum si_cache_policyMarek Olšák2-26/+41
2018-08-14radeonsi: declare coher in si_copy_bufferMarek Olšák1-8/+7
2018-08-14radeonsi: make PFP_SYNC_ME an explicit CP DMA flagMarek Olšák1-17/+25
2018-08-14radeonsi: don't use emit_data->args in load_emitMarek Olšák1-94/+37
2018-08-14radeonsi: don't use emit_data->args in store_emitMarek Olšák1-92/+71
2018-08-14radeonsi: don't use emit_data->args in atomic_emitMarek Olšák3-36/+47
2018-08-14radeonsi: don't use emit_data->args in build_interp_intrinsicMarek Olšák1-19/+13
2018-08-14radeonsi: inline atomic_fetch_argsMarek Olšák1-74/+51
2018-08-14radeonsi: inline store_fetch_argsMarek Olšák1-61/+42
2018-08-14radeonsi: inline load_fetch_argsMarek Olšák1-39/+28
2018-08-14radeonsi: merge txq_emit and resq_emitMarek Olšák1-48/+45
2018-08-14radeonsi: inline resq_fetch_argsMarek Olšák1-62/+34
2018-08-14radeonsi: inline txq_fetch_argsMarek Olšák1-26/+7
2018-08-14radeonsi: use get_resinfo directly in lower_gather4_integerMarek Olšák1-13/+12
2018-08-14radeonsi: inline tex_fetch_args into build_tex_intrinsicMarek Olšák1-222/+188
2018-08-14radeonsi: remove fetch_args callbacks for ALU instructionsMarek Olšák2-103/+55
2018-08-14radeonsi: move internal TGSI shaders into si_shaderlib_tgsi.cMarek Olšák8-319/+348
2018-08-14radeonsi: implement EXT_window_rectanglesMarek Olšák7-2/+95
2018-08-10meson: Build with Python 3Mathieu Bridon1-1/+1
2018-08-07radeonsi: set GLC=1 for all write-only shader resourcesMarek Olšák1-2/+19
2018-08-07radeonsi: don't load block dimensions into SGPRs if they are not variableMarek Olšák3-7/+7
2018-08-04radeonsi: cosmetic changesMarek Olšák5-6/+5
2018-08-03amd: remove support for LLVM 5.0Marek Olšák3-36/+3
2018-08-02radeonsi: add new R600_DEBUG test "testclearbufperf"Darren Powell8-11/+170
2018-08-01ac,radeonsi: reduce optimizations for complex compute shaders on older APUs (v2)Marek Olšák4-9/+43
2018-07-31radeonsi: report supported EQAA combinations from is_format_supportedMarek Olšák1-16/+20
2018-07-31radeonsi: use storage_samples instead of color_samples in most placesMarek Olšák4-38/+24
2018-07-31gallium: add storage_sample_count parameter into is_format_supportedMarek Olšák2-1/+5
2018-07-31gallium: add PIPE_CAP_FRAMEBUFFER_MSAA_CONSTRAINTSMarek Olšák1-0/+2
2018-07-26ac: fix typo DSL_SEL -> DST_SELMarek Olšák1-2/+2
2018-07-26radeonsi: update a comment about cache behaviorMarek Olšák1-3/+3
2018-07-24radeonsi: handle SI_FORCE_FAMILY earlyMarek Olšák1-2/+1
2018-07-23radeonsi: fix pk2h breakageMarek Olšák1-2/+5
2018-07-23radeonsi: reduce LDS stalls by 40% for tessellationMarek Olšák4-6/+14
2018-07-23radeonsi: Add debug option to enable LLVM GlobalISel (v2)Tom Stellard2-0/+4
2018-07-23radeonsi/nir: make use of nir_lower_load_const_to_scalar()Timothy Arceri1-0/+2
2018-07-21Android: fix a missing nir_intrinsics.h errorChih-Wei Huang1-0/+2
2018-07-20radeonsi: emit_spi_map packets optimizationSonny Jiang4-8/+39
2018-07-18radeonsi: emit_guardband packets optimizationSonny Jiang4-8/+50
2018-07-18radeonsi: Save CLEAR_STATE initial values for optimizationSonny Jiang1-2/+26
2018-07-18radeonsi: Refuse to accept code with unhandled relocationsJan Vesely1-0/+6
2018-07-18radeonsi: Use signed char for color_interp_vgpr_indexTimothy Pearson1-1/+1
2018-07-16radeonsi: rework RADEON_PRIO flags to be <= 31Marek Olšák1-2/+2
2018-07-16radeonsi: merge DCC/CMASK/HTILE priority flagsMarek Olšák3-6/+4
2018-07-16radeonsi: remove non-GFX BO priority flagsMarek Olšák2-8/+2
2018-07-12radeonsi: add support for Vega20Marek Olšák4-1/+5